Output 51c33d6f383c35993a946eaba4abe242494ece9f11e32ce24cd0300ea34d7b4d:35

value
161338
script pubkey
OP_0 OP_PUSHBYTES_20 fbb6fa5e5f02f7326a34eae22056b006b14fa7f3
address
bc1qlwm05hjlqtmny635at3zq44sq6c5lflnuzkchg
transaction
51c33d6f383c35993a946eaba4abe242494ece9f11e32ce24cd0300ea34d7b4d
spent
true